How to Lock DWG File from Editing?

Understanding the Need to Lock DWG Files

DWG files are widely used for digital drawings and designs, particularly in engineering and architecture. Given their importance, protecting these files from unauthorized edits or replication is crucial. Locking a DWG file ensures that it can only be accessed in a read-only format by other users, safeguarding the integrity of your work.

Steps to Lock a DWG File from Editing

Step 1: Open AutoCAD

Begin by launching the AutoCAD application on your computer. Ensure that you are using AutoCAD 2025 for the procedures described here.

Step 2: Access the File in Question

Navigate to the location of the DWG file you want to lock. This could be done through the AutoCAD interface or directly via your file explorer.

Step 3: Change File Properties

  1. Right-click on the DWG File: Once you locate the file, right-click to open the context menu.
  2. Select Properties: Click on the "Properties" option to access a new window displaying various attributes of the file.
  3. Modify Read-Only Settings: Look for the "Attributes" section and find the option labeled "Read-only." Check this box to prevent further edits. Confirm your selection by clicking “OK” to save the changes.

Step 5: Open as Read-Only (For Others)

If you wish to allow others to view the DWG file without editing, instruct them to follow these steps:

  1. Open AutoCAD: Start the application.
  2. Access the Open Files Menu: Click on “Open Files” within the AutoCAD interface.
  3. Select the DWG File: Locate and highlight the file in question.
  4. Choose Read-Only Option: Click on the dropdown arrow next to the “OPEN” button and select “Open Read-Only.”

Additional Methods to Secure Your DWG File

Convert to DWF or PDF

If sharing the file with parties who do not require editing capabilities, consider converting the DWG file to a DWF (Design Web Format) or PDF. These formats permit sharing without granting editing privileges:

  1. Conversion Process: Use a file conversion tool within AutoCAD or an external program to convert the DWG into your desired format.
  2. Distribute the File: Share the resulting DWF or PDF file, ensuring that your designs remain protected from unwanted modifications.

FAQs

Can I unlock a DWG file after it has been set to read-only?

Yes, you can unlock a DWG file by accessing its properties again and unchecking the "Read-only" option.

Is it possible to lock a whole folder of DWG files?

You can lock a folder containing DWG files by changing its properties to "Read-only." However, each individual DWG file must also have its own properties adjusted to prevent editing.
